Core Network Switches Upgrade

This is to inform you about a scheduled upgrade activity on our core network switches.

Maintenance Date and window : 6th April 2022 from 0230 hsr to 0400 hsr IST

Downtime: Partial (Fluctuation in the Network for less than 120 sec)

Impact: There is a chance of network fluctuation for our few customers while performing the activity.

Few important impact points related to this maintenance activity

Myaccount Portal: Our E2E Myaccount portal will not be accessible during the downtime.

Compute nodes: There will be a disconnect of the network (both public and private) for a period of 2 minutes or less for all the compute nodes in the Noida (NCR) location.

Volumes (or BlockStorage): There will be a disconnect between the BlockStorage volumes and the nodes they are attached to which may cause I/O error while the volume is being accessed. We recommend verifying the accessibility of the BlockStorage volumes from the concerned node and trying unmounting and mounting the volume again if you face any issue in accessing it post activity. In case unmounting and mounting doesn’t make it accessible, try detaching and attaching the volume again post activity to get it functional again. Please refer here to know more about detaching and attaching BlockStorage volumes. We recommend you unmount the BlockStorage volumes before the activity and remount them once the activity is completed to avoid the aforementioned issues.

Object Storage: The buckets and objects will not be accessible during the downtime period.

We request you to take the above maintenance into consideration & plan your activities accordingly.

Note: If you have a cluster-based setup on your compute nodes, due to this network interruption between nodes, there could be a break in the cluster. We suggest you set it on a standalone mode so that you can resume sync between them post the activity is completed.

For example, if you have a PCS based cluster, DRBD cluster, Mongo Cluster, or any clusters, etc.

    Network Status Network Reachability Issue

    We are observing and also reported network reachability issue in our Delhi(NCR) region zone. We are investigating it currently and will keep you posted on further findings.

  • Update - 14:00 IST, 16 March 2022

    We had network disruptions for multiple durations (15 mins avg multiple times ) on 14th and one degradation on 15th for about 10 mins. We have investigated this extensively and have a preliminary analysis of the events and the mitigation being done and steps being taken to ensure the issues don't recur.

    We had a differentiated DDoS (Distributed Denial of Service) Attacks and the variation was of targets also being highly distributed across our entire network. We have mitigated this novel DDoS by using blockhole filters to negate the traffic inflow. The network is currently stable for the last 16 hours and we are closely watching this.
